Dear Alvaro: is is some background on this change of behavior. The key mapping has indeed been modified recently, and may change again in a future version (e.g. based on your input). I suggested this change to Joris as buffers are not used by typical MacOS applications: instead, applications would typically open different windows or use tabs (but unfortunately tabs don't work so far in TeXmacs). My understanding is that the recent change has been limited to MacOS but I am not sure.
